2017-04-18 25 views
0

我有以下事实表:PlaceId,DateId,StatisticId,StatisticValue。 而且我有统计Id和其名称的维度如下:StatisticId,StatisticName。加载灵活的事实表SSIS

我想加载与2统计数据的事实表。有了这个架构,我的数据的每一行将在我的事实表中用2行表示。

该数据具有以下属性:Place,Date,Stat1_Value,Stat2_Value。

如何加载我的事实表与这些措施的ID及其相应的值。

谢谢。

回答

0

我会使用SSIS将数据移动到与您的数据具有相同列的保留表中。然后调用一个使用SQL填充事实表的存储过程,使用UNION获取所有Stat1_Values,然后获取所有Stat2_Values。